What To Expect
The adventure begins the moment you set foot on our vessel! Our tours are set up safari style which means from the start of the tour we are going to be scanning the gorgeous and dramatic coastline of Kona for any type of wildlife to observe and interact with. With the rapid and deep drop off of the sea floor along the coast, we have the potential to see shallow water animals as well as pelagic (deep, open ocean) marine life. While nature is unpredictable and we cannot guarantee any specific interactions or observations, we have the potential to see sea turtles, various fish species, dolphin and whale species, sharks, and manta rays. We’ll have four hours on the water to provide you with the best experience imaginable. Please note we go into deep water for open ocean wildlife on nearly every tour & the search for pelagic life can take some time. Please note you should be able to swim, have a degree of athleticism, & climb up a ladder to participate in the water. This may not be the tour for beginners or some children. *Please review our cancelation policy & if you are joining from a cruise ship you need to confirm with them 24 hours prior they will let you off of the ship.
